In the ever-evolving landscape of blockchain technology, the need for efficient network load management has become paramount. Cardano (ADA), a leading cryptocurrency platform, recognizes the importance of scalability and has implemented a robust load management mechanism to ensure optimal performance.
This article explores the fundamentals of Cardano’s load management system and delves into the strategies employed to enhance efficiency.
Additionally, it examines the crucial role of stake pool operators in ADA’s scalability and discusses the significance of monitoring and analyzing network performance.
By understanding the intricacies of network load management in Cardano, stakeholders can make informed decisions to maximize efficiency and contribute to the platform’s overall success.
Key Takeaways
- Cardano’s layered architecture and Ouroboros consensus algorithm ensure network security, efficiency, and scalability.
- Adaptive block size and transactions throughput strategies enable the network to dynamically adjust and enhance its capacity.
- Network load management in Cardano involves prioritizing transactions, dynamic adjustments to ledger parameters, network sharding, and parallel processing.
- Stake pool operators play a crucial role in load balancing, promoting network decentralization, and optimizing the staking mechanism to prevent congestion.
Understanding Cardano Network Load Management for Enhanced Scalability
To enhance scalability, understanding the network load management in Cardano (ADA) is crucial. Cardano, a blockchain platform, aims to provide a secure and efficient environment for transactions. Network load management refers to the strategies employed to ensure the smooth functioning of the network while maintaining high levels of efficiency and scalability.
One of the key strategies for network load management in Cardano is the implementation of a layered architecture. This allows for the separation of different components, such as the transaction layer and the settlement layer, enabling the network to handle a higher volume of transactions without sacrificing performance.
Additionally, Cardano utilizes a consensus algorithm called Ouroboros, which ensures that the network remains secure and efficient even as the number of participants increases. This algorithm allows for the delegation of stake, which further enhances scalability by distributing the workload across multiple participants.
Deepen your grasp of ADA Scalability with the extended analysis found in Cardano High Throughput Techniques.
The Fundamentals of Cardano’s Load Management Mechanism
Cardano’s load management mechanism is built on the foundation of the Ouroboros protocol. This protocol plays a crucial role in managing network traffic. It ensures that the network remains secure and efficient by dynamically adjusting the block size and transactions throughput based on the current network conditions.
The Role of Ouroboros Protocol in Managing Network Traffic
The Ouroboros Protocol plays a crucial role in managing network traffic in Cardano (ADA), ensuring the efficiency of its load management mechanism. As Cardano aims to provide scalable solutions, the network load management becomes essential to maintain high throughput and accommodate increasing demand.
The Ouroboros Protocol, the underlying consensus algorithm of Cardano, has been designed to address these challenges effectively. By using a proof-of-stake mechanism, it enables secure and efficient transaction processing while minimizing energy consumption.
This protocol also incorporates off-chain solutions, allowing for faster transaction confirmation times and reducing the burden on the network. With its unique approach to network traffic management, the Ouroboros Protocol contributes to Cardano’s goal of achieving scalability and high throughput, making it a promising platform for future blockchain applications.
Adaptive Block Size and Transactions Throughput
One critical aspect of Cardano’s load management mechanism entails the adaptability of block size and transactions throughput. This adaptive approach allows Cardano to address the scalability challenges that arise in blockchain technology.
Here are four key points to understand about Cardano’s adaptive block size and transactions throughput:
- Cardano’s layer scaling architecture enables the network to handle increasing transaction volumes by dynamically adjusting the block size. This ensures efficient utilization of network resources while maintaining decentralization.
- To overcome scalability limitations, Cardano is constantly developing innovative solutions. These include implementing sharding techniques, sidechains, and off-chain protocols to enhance the network’s overall capacity.
- Cardano’s future scalability plans involve upgrading the network’s infrastructure to support higher transaction throughput without compromising security and decentralization. This includes exploring layer-two solutions like Lightning Network and state channels.
- The adaptability of block size and transactions throughput in Cardano’s load management mechanism reflects the project’s commitment to scalability and efficiency, laying the foundation for a robust and scalable blockchain network.
Through these scalability innovations, Cardano aims to provide a secure and scalable platform for conducting transactions in a decentralized manner.
Implementing Effective Strategies for Cardano Network Load Management
To effectively manage the network load in Cardano, several strategies can be implemented.
One approach is to prioritize transactions based on a weight-based system, which assigns different priorities to transactions based on their importance.
Additionally, dynamic adjustments to the ledger parameters can be made to optimize the network’s performance and adapt to changing conditions.
Another strategy is network sharding and parallel processing, which involves dividing the network into smaller sections and processing transactions simultaneously, reducing congestion and increasing efficiency.
These strategies play a crucial role in maintaining the efficiency and scalability of the Cardano network.
Prioritizing Transactions with a Weight-Based System
Implementing an efficient strategy for Cardano network load management involves prioritizing transactions using a weight-based system. This approach ensures that the most important transactions are processed first, optimizing the overall performance and scalability of the network.
Here are four key aspects of this weight-based system:
- Scalability Innovations: Cardano incorporates various scalability innovations to handle a larger number of transactions efficiently, including sharding and sidechain technology.
- Asset Prioritization: Transactions involving high-value assets or critical operations are assigned higher weights, ensuring their timely processing.
- Node Consensus: The weight assigned to a transaction is determined through a consensus mechanism among the network nodes, ensuring fairness and decentralization.
- Infrastructure Optimization: The weight-based system allows for efficient allocation of network resources, optimizing the utilization of computational power and storage capacity.
Dynamic Ledger Parameters Adjustments
The implementation of dynamic ledger parameters adjustments plays a crucial role in ensuring effective strategies for network load management in Cardano (ADA).
By dynamically adjusting the parameters of the Cardano ledger, the platform can optimize its performance and scalability, allowing for efficient handling of network load. These adjustments are based on real-time analysis of factors such as transaction volume, network congestion, and available resources.
To better understand the impact of dynamic ledger parameter adjustments, consider the following table:
Parameter | Description | Adjustment Strategy |
---|---|---|
Block Size Limit | Maximum size of a block in the blockchain | Increase block size during high demand |
Transaction Fees | Cost paid by users for processing transactions | Adjust fees based on network congestion |
Block Time Interval | Time between the creation of two consecutive blocks | Increase block time during low demand |
Network Bandwidth | Maximum data transfer rate allowed by the network | Prioritize critical traffic during high load |
Transaction Throughput | Number of transactions processed per second | Optimize throughput based on network capacity |
Network Sharding and Parallel Processing
Network sharding and parallel processing are key strategies for effectively managing network load in Cardano (ADA). These scalability innovations allow for increased speed and efficiency in network operations, ensuring a smooth user experience.
Here are four important points to understand about network sharding and parallel processing in the context of Cardano:
- Sharding: Network sharding involves dividing the network into smaller, more manageable pieces called shards. Each shard is responsible for processing a subset of transactions, reducing the overall load on the network and improving scalability.
- Speed: By implementing network sharding, Cardano can process transactions in parallel across multiple shards. This parallel processing significantly increases the network’s throughput and reduces transaction confirmation times.
- Efficiency: Network sharding and parallel processing enable Cardano to efficiently utilize network resources. By distributing the workload across multiple shards, the network can handle a higher volume of transactions without sacrificing performance or increasing costs.
- Effective load management: With network sharding and parallel processing, Cardano can dynamically allocate resources to manage network load. This ensures that the network remains efficient even during periods of high demand, maintaining a smooth and reliable user experience.
The Impact of Stake Pool Operators on ADA Scalability
Stake pool operators play a crucial role in the scalability of Cardano’s ADA network. Understanding the impact of stake pool operators on ADA scalability is key to optimizing network performance and ensuring the smooth operation of the Cardano ecosystem.
Through staking, participants contribute to network congestion, and the efficient load balancing provided by stake pool operators is essential for maintaining scalability.
Staking and Its Influence on Network Congestion
Staking plays a crucial role in the scalability of ADA, as stake pool operators significantly impact network congestion. Here are four key ways in which staking influences network congestion in Cardano:
- Rewards Distribution: Stake pool operators are responsible for distributing rewards to stakers. Efficiently managing this process ensures that rewards are allocated promptly and accurately, reducing congestion caused by delays.
- Decentralization: By encouraging staking, Cardano aims to achieve a more decentralized network. This helps to distribute the load across multiple stakeholders, preventing any single entity from overwhelming the network.
- Incentivizing Stake Pool Operators: Effective incentivization mechanisms ensure that stake pool operators are motivated to maintain efficient operations. This helps in preventing network congestion caused by poorly managed or overloaded stake pools.
- Protocol Upgrades: Cardano’s continuous protocol upgrades address scalability concerns by implementing improvements to the staking mechanism. These upgrades aim to optimize the network’s efficiency and reduce the likelihood of congestion.
How Stake Pool Operators Contribute to Efficient Load Balancing
Stake pool operators play a crucial role in achieving efficient load balancing and optimizing ADA scalability in Cardano.
These operators, who are responsible for running the nodes that validate transactions on the Cardano network, help distribute the network load evenly among different pools. By managing the stake delegated to their pools, they ensure that no single pool becomes too large and dominates the network, which can lead to centralization and decreased efficiency.
To illustrate the impact of stake pool operators on ADA scalability, consider the following table:
Stake Pool Operator | Stake Delegated (ADA) | Contribution to Load Balancing |
---|---|---|
1PCT (1 Percent Pool) | ~50,000,000 | High |
BLOOM (Bloom Pool) | ~40,000,000 | High |
DIGI (Digital Fortress) | ~30,000,000 | Medium |
KIWI (Kiwi Pool) | ~15,000,000 | Medium |
ADAOZ (ADAOZ Pool) | ~5,000,000 | Low |
These examples represent a range of stake pool operators, from large to smaller pools, showing how they contribute to load balancing and decentralization in the Cardano ecosystem. The figures for stake delegated are approximations and can vary over time. The classification of their contribution to load balancing (high, medium, low) is also indicative, based on their relative size and influence in the network.
Monitoring and Analyzing Network Performance in Cardano
Monitoring and analyzing network performance in Cardano is crucial for maintaining the efficiency and scalability of the platform.
By utilizing tools for measuring network load in real-time, stakeholders can identify potential bottlenecks and optimize their operations accordingly.
Additionally, community-driven improvements play a vital role in sustaining performance by addressing issues proactively and implementing solutions that cater to the evolving needs of the network.
Tools for Measuring Network Load in Real-Time
How can network load in Cardano be measured and analyzed in real-time to ensure efficient performance?
To achieve this, there are several tools available that can help monitor and measure network load. These tools provide valuable insights into the performance of the Cardano network, allowing for proactive load management strategies to be implemented.
Here are four tools that can be used for measuring network load in real-time:
- Network Traffic Analysis Tools: These tools capture and analyze network traffic, providing detailed information about the volume and patterns of data flow in the network.
- Network Monitoring Tools: These tools monitor various network parameters such as bandwidth usage, latency, and packet loss, allowing for real-time analysis of network performance.
- Load Testing Tools: Load testing tools simulate high levels of network traffic to assess the network’s capacity and identify potential bottlenecks.
- Performance Monitoring Tools: These tools continuously monitor the performance of the network and provide real-time metrics on factors such as response time and throughput.
The Importance of Community-Driven Improvements for Sustained Performance
To ensure sustained performance in Cardano’s network, community-driven improvements play a crucial role in monitoring and analyzing network performance.
Cardano’s ecosystem relies on the active participation and collaboration of its community to identify and address any issues that may arise.
Through continuous monitoring, the community can detect potential bottlenecks, congestion, or other inefficiencies in the network load management.
By analyzing network performance data, the community can gain valuable insights into how the network is functioning and identify areas for improvement.
This community-driven approach ensures that Cardano remains efficient and optimized, as it allows for timely adjustments and enhancements to be made based on real-time data and feedback.
Additionally, community-driven improvements foster a sense of ownership and shared responsibility, further strengthening the network’s resilience and long-term viability.
Frequently Asked Questions
How Does Cardano’s Network Load Management Mechanism Differ From Other Blockchain Networks?
Cardano’s network load management mechanism distinguishes itself from other blockchain networks through its focus on efficiency and scalability. By utilizing a unique consensus algorithm, Ouroboros, Cardano is able to optimize network performance and handle increased transactional demands effectively.
What Factors Contribute to the Scalability of the Cardano Network?
Factors contributing to the scalability of the Cardano network include its use of a layered architecture, the implementation of the Ouroboros protocol, and the ability to parallelize transactions. These factors enable efficient processing and handling of increasing network loads.
What Strategies Can Be Employed to Optimize Network Load Management in Cardano?
Strategies for optimizing network load management in Cardano involve implementing efficient consensus protocols, improving network infrastructure, and utilizing load balancing techniques. These measures ensure scalability, reliability, and high-performance of the network, enhancing overall efficiency.
How Do Stake Pool Operators Impact the Scalability of ADA?
Stake pool operators play a crucial role in the scalability of ADA by managing network load effectively. Their expertise in optimizing resources and implementing efficient strategies ensures smooth operations and facilitates the growth and scalability of the Cardano network.
What Tools and Techniques Are Available for Monitoring and Analyzing Network Performance in Cardano?
There are various tools and techniques available for monitoring and analyzing network performance in Cardano. These include network monitoring software, performance testing tools, and data analytics platforms that provide insights into network efficiency and identify areas for improvement.
Conclusion
Effective network load management is crucial for enhancing scalability in the Cardano blockchain.
By understanding the fundamentals of Cardano’s load management mechanism and implementing efficient strategies, the network can handle increased transaction volume and maintain optimal performance.
Stake pool operators play a significant role in ADA scalability and should be monitored and analyzed to ensure efficient network operations.
Continuously monitoring and analyzing network performance is essential for identifying and addressing any potential bottlenecks or issues that may arise.